About This App

PhotoDirector 365 is CyberLink's subscription-based photo editing application for macOS, offering tools for RAW processing, colour correction, composition adjustment, retouching, layering and creative effects. It serves casual photographers and enthusiasts who want a middle-ground between smartphone photo apps and professional software like Lightroom or Capture One, combining quick edits with more advanced features like non-destructive RAW support, content-aware removal, and AI-powered enhancement tools.
